Jurnal Kedokteran Gigi Terpadu publishes articles and scientific work from Researches, Case Reports and Literature Reviews in Dentistry and Dental Science. The scopes vary from: Dental Surgery, Dental Forensics, Oral Biology, Oral Medicine, Dental Public Health and Preventive Dentistry, Paediatric Dentistry, Dental Materials and Technology, Conservative Dentistry,Orthodontics,Periodontics,Prosthodontics,Dental Radiology.

Abstract

Backgrounds: Severe class II skeletal malocclusion could cause unfavorable facial appearance and impairments of mastication, swallowing, speaking, and breathing functions. Mouth breathing is one of the etiologies of malocclusion, caused by the narrowing of upper pharyngeal width. The aim of this study is to determine the upper pharyngeal width of class I and class II skeletal malocclusion. Materials and Methods: This study is an analytic observational method with cross sectional study design. Cephalogram samples are taken from patients of Trisakti University Dental Hospital in 2016-2017. The analysis is performed by measuring angles of SNA, SNB, ANB (class I, ANB: 2-4° and class II, ANB>4°), and upper pharyngeal width according to McNamara Analysis. Results: Average SNA angle is 8,40° (± 3,91), average SNB angle is 75,82° (± 3,62), average ANB angle is 4,58° (± 1,55), average upper pharyngeal width is 9,24 mm (± 2,20), average upper pharyngeal width of class I skeletal malocclusion group is 9,47 mm (± 2,37), and average upper pharyngeal width of class II skeletal malocclusion group is 9,01 mm (± 2,04). Conclusion: Average upper pharyngeal width of class I skeletal malocclusion is 9,47 mm (± 2,37) and average upper pharyngeal width of class II skeletal malocclusion is 9,01 mm (± 2,04).

Abstract

Background: Cephalometric analysis is an important tool in the field of orthodontics. It is used to examine the growth and development of facial bones in treatment planning, and changes between before and after treatment in evaluation stage. Steiner's analysis uses angle dan distance measurements to determine the patient's skeletal position. Steiner's analysis includes the position and inclination of the incisors to the jaw and the position of the jaw to the cranial base. This study was thus carried out to describe the value of cephalometric parameter measurements of Deutro-Malay race patients aged 6-12 years using Steiner's analysis. Materials and Methods: This study is a descriptive observational method with a cross-sectional study design. Samples were taken from secondary data of cephalogram orthodontic patients RSGM FKG Usakti in 2017-2018. The analysis was carried out by measuring 11 Steiner's analysis parameters, namely: SNA, SNB, SND, ANB, Go-Gn to SN, U1-NA, L1-NB, U1-L1, Occl-SN. Results: Based on Steiner's analysis, the cephalometric mean value of RSGM FKG Usakti orthodontic patients was SNA of 80.80; SNB of 76.60; SND of 72.990; ANB of 4,240; Go-Gn to SN is 36.80; U1-NA is 26,920 and 3,93 mm; L1-NB of 32.10 and 5.98 mm; U1-L1 of 116,890; Occl-SN is 20,680. Conclusions: Malay Deutro Race has a tendency for class II, skeletal class II malocclusion, retrusive symphysis, less developed horizontal growth patterns, and incisive proclination.

Abstract

Background: Periodontal disease could mediate the systemic effect through the action of periodontal pathogens and lipopolisacharide that  increase postaglandin and cytokine production, which will trigger the delivery of preterm low birth weight. Pregnant woman with periodontitis have significantly higher risk to deliver preterm low birth weight infants <37 weeks gestation period, and birth weight < 2500 gram. Periodontal therapy significantly reduces the rates of preterm low birth weight among women with periodontitis. Conclusions: It is concluded that periodontal disease as an independent risk factor for preterm low birth weight. Plaque control procedure during pregnancy should be considered to reduce the occurrence of preterm.

Abstract

Background: Bulk-fill composite resin is a tooth-colored restoration material that is developed to obtain better aesthetic and mechanical properties, which include compressive strength. The factors influencing the reduction of compressive strength of composite resin are hydrophilic matrix monomers and inadequate bonds between compositions. One of the absorbable liquids is a mouthwash commonly used to control dental caries and reduce the amount of plaque after brushing the teeth. Objective: To determine the effect of mouthwash containing 9% alcohol and nonalcohol on the compressive strength of bulk-fill composite resin. Method: The research type conducted is an experimental laboratory. The compressive strength of bulk-fill composite resin will be tested using Universal Testing Machine. There were three treatment groups, which are immersion in mouthwash containing 9% alcohol, nonalcohol, and artificial saliva as a control group. Samples were immersed at room temperature 25°C for 12 hours according to instructions for use twice a day for 30 seconds. Results: The One Way ANOVA test shows a significant value, which was sig. 0.001 (p < 0.05). There were significant differences in the test of the effect of mouthwash containing 9% alcohol and nonalcohol mouthwash on the compressive strength of bulk-fill composite resin. This result is caused by the hydrophilic traits of the matrix monomers, mechanisms that occur in resin compositions, acidity and alcohol content of mouthwash can affect the reduction in compressive strength of the composite resin. Conclusion: The mouthwash containing 9% alcohol reduced the compressive strength of bulk-fill composite resin more compared to nonalcohol mouthwash.

Abstract

Latar belakang : Salah satu cara memutihkan gigi adalah menyikat gigi dengan pasta gigi ya yang mengandung bahan pemutih. Setiap produk memiliki kandungan bahan pemutih yang berbeda-beda. Keefektifannya perlu diuji terhadap pewarnaan gigi ekstrinsik. Tujuan: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k menganalisis efektitifitas pasta gigi pemutih terhadap gigi yang berubah warna karena kopi. Metode: Empat puluh gigi premolar direndam dalam larutan kopi selama 2 minggu. Sampel lalu dibagi menjadi 4 kelompok berdasarkan pasta gigi yang digunakan. Pengukuran warna awal dilakukan dengan alat VITA Easyshade. Penyikatan gigi dilakukan selama 14 hari, setelah itu warna gigi diukur kembali. Hasil: Uji Kruskal-Wallis menunjukkan terdapat perbedaan bermakna dalam penggunaan pasta gigi pemutih terhadap perubahan warna gigi (p<0,05). Perbedaan rata-rata perubahan warna gigi (ΔE) setelah aplikasi pasta gigi pemutih dengan perlite adalah 6,6±1,7; Speedy Whitening Agent (SWA) adalah 5,7±2,72; micro-cleansing crystal adalah 3±2,33; dan pasta gigi tanpa pemutih adalah 2,1± 0,37. Kesimpulan: Pasta gigi pemutih dan tanpa pemutih efektif terhadap perubahan warna gigi ekstrinsik karena kopi. Pasta gigi pemutih dengan kandungan perlite merupakan pasta gigi yang paling efektif.

Abstract

Background:  Value of the appearance of one’s teeth has taken on a greater importance in today’s society. Several Choices of treatment are available to treat the problems arising in the zone of high esthetic sensitivity. Each treatment offers some advantages and disadvantages. The use of porcelain laminate veneers to solve esthetic and functional problems has been shown to be a valid management option especially in the anterior esthetic zone. Smile design is a scientific principal that can help operators to achieve esthetic goals. This case report discussed a patient with diastema in the anterior region with protrusive dental position. The patient was treated with porcelain laminate veneers in the anterior teeth for diastema closure. Objective: This case report was written to bring forward the proper and successful management in esthetic treatment of anterior maxilla in protrusive dental position case. Case and management : A 37 year-old female patient complained of diastema in anterior teeth and feels uncomfortable with her condition. She was unhappy with the appearance of her teeth and restrained herself from smiling due to self-consciousness. On examination, diastemas were found in her maxillary and mandibular anterior region. Smile Design was applied in this patient, and it was decided to use porcelain laminate veneer. The tooth preparation was kept in enamel at a depth of 0.5 mm using a depth cutting diamond and a tapered diamond 1 mm in diameter. 0.25 mm chamfer was maintained in the cervical region The chamfer finish lines were at the level of gingival margin. Gingival retraction procedure was performed prior to final dental impression using a double impression technique. Cementation was done after final evaluation of both aesthetic and function. Conclusion: Esthetic management in diastema closure  using simple smile design can be done by using porcelain laminate veneers which give satisfactory result.

Abstract

Background: In the medical world, drugs are often used as medicine in medication and science development. There is a connection between drug abuse and oral health problems. Oral health status significantly affects one’s life quality. Research results in several countries have shown a poor life quality among drug abusers. In Indonesia, there has never been any research conducted on life quality overview in connection with dental and oral health among drug abusers, by using OHRQoL instrument, especially the ‘Oral Impact on Daily Performance’. Objective: The purpose of this research is to create an overview of the quality of life in relation to drug abusers dental and oral health. Methods:This research is descriptive observational type, which uses the Cross sectional approach and total sampling method. Respondents are recipients of metadon therapy in Grogol Petamburan Municipality Health Center. Data gathering was conducted by obtaining questionnaires which were immediately completed by respondents. Results: There were 49 respondents in this research. Drug addicts often experience difficulty in chewing (32.7%), speech disorders (26.5%), absence of pain in oral cavity (36.7%), sleep disorders as a result of dental and oral health issues (32.7%), infrequent pain prior to sleep (36.7%), embarrassment due to dental and oral issues (30.6%), dental and oral problems-induced irritability (36.7%). Conclusions: As an overall conclusion, drug abusers experience poor life quality in relation to dental and oral heatlh

Abstract

Background: Restoration after endodontic treatment is still a challenge that must be performed by doctors in daily practice. The gold standard treatment for this case is post-core crown. However, this aggressive preparation for post-core crown does not in line with the minimally invasive concept in modern dentistry. Objective: To restore the function and aesthetic of maxillary first molars after endodontic treatment using Endocrown. Case: A 54-year-old male patient came to the clinic with a broken amalgam restoration on the first right upper molar since 3 months ago. The restoration was felt sharp thus iritate the tongue. On clinical and radiographic examination, an old amalgam restoration was seen on the occlusal surface and had reached the pulp. At the first visit, one visit endodontic was done with warm vertical condensation technique. Gutta-percha masterpoint was cut until ⅓ apical was filled and at ⅓ middle and ⅓ coronal the root canal was filled with injectable thermoplastized gutta-percha which is compacted until 2 mm below the orifice. On the next visit, gutta percha was cut as much as 2 mm and filled with core material as intraradicular retention as deep as 4 mm. Preparation is made by the butt-joint equigingival margin around the surface with a retention cavity in the middle of the pulp chamber. After the completion of tooth preparation, the impression was made with polyvinyl siloxane silicone. At the third visit, endocrown was tested to check the marginal fit and accuracy, then cemented using resin cement, and checked using radiography. Conclusion: Endocrown can serve as an alternative restoration which is conservative, have good aesthetic, functional, and minimally invasive.

Abstract

Background: Surface roughness at restoration and the tooth surface can be caused by the routine activity of brushing and abrasive materials contained in toothpaste. Surface roughness causes bacterial colonization and affects oral and dental health. Objective: This study aimed to determine the effect of the use of a toothbrush and toothpaste child against GIC and compomer surface roughness. Method: This study was an experimental laboratory. Comparison of surface roughness using surface roughness tester before and after brushing on 2 group samples of GIC and compomer with speed of 1 mm/sec and a load of 200 grams, which is assumed as the pressure when brushing teeth. Results: The results of paired t-test calculations on compomer before tooth brushing were 0.3468 ± 0.8801 μm and after brushing was 2.9528 ± 0.7252 μm with p = 0.001 (p <0.05). While the results of the roughness test data at the surface of SIK before tooth brushing was 0.7314 ± 0.3810 µm and after brushing was 3.2102 ± 0.9522 µm with p = 0.003 (p <0.05). The result showed that there is a significant difference in surface roughness of SIK and compomer before and after brushing significantly. Unpaired t-test was performed on both test groups (p = 0.058: p> 0.05) showed no significant difference between surface roughness at SIK and compomer restorations Conclusion: The use of abrasive in toothpaste and tooth brushing routine caused surface roughness at GIC and Compomer restorations. The surface roughness value on both of the restoration materials was higher after simulating tooth brushing.

Abstract

Background: The discoloration of teeth is a common aesthetic concern for many patients. It can have a profound effect on their self-esteem, interaction with others and employability. Dental bleaching can be used as a treatment for teeth that are discolored due to intrinsic and extrinsic staining. Vital bleaching is an in-office procedure which utilize 25-40% hydrogen peroxides. Home-bleaching with gels containing 10%, 15%, or 20% carbamide peroxide is recommended after in-office procedure. Objective: To overview planning and treatment of vital discoloration teeth with combination in-office and home-bleaching procedure. Case: A 31 year old patient complained about her lack of confidence due to yellow looking teeth. The patient told the dentist she used to consume coffee at least twice a day. Measuring teeth color with Vitapan shade guide (VITA Zahnfabrik) resulted in A3 color for maxillary teeth and A3,5 for mandibular teeth as well as shade guide opalescence results in A3,5 color. The teeth were fully cleaned with brush. Gingiva area was isolated using opaldam, and it was activated using light curing unit  for 10 seconds in each servikal area. Bleaching material was applied to six anterior teeth and first maxillary and mandibular premolar in 20 minutes, it was activated every 5 minute by stirring bleaching material with tip brush. After done with the procedure, bleaching material was cleaned with suction, whipped by using cotton pellet. Color matching was done after in-office bleaching process using Vitapan shade guide (VITA Zahnfabrik), it was attained A1 color for maxillary teeth and A2 for mandibular teeth. Color matching using shade guide opalescence resulted in W3 color. The patient was instructed to use individual tray  through gel containing carbamide peroxide 10% for 8 hours on each day for 1 full week. Conclusion: In-office and home-bleaching procedure is the treatment of choice in vital discoloration of teeth.
